Playcrackersthesky t1_jcljoso wrote
I know you want to avoid agencies, but care.com has a specific section for elder care. You can select candidates with college degrees, with medical training, with elder care experience. Itâs probably worth the $30 to register and browse candidates to interview. You can arrange to pay them in cash.

treskro t1_jcl5rak wrote
Reply to Where is Edison's Chinatown? by Top_Ad5385
around Rt 27 strip malls, plazas around Kam Man on Old Post Rd, some parts of Rt 1. Most of the non-food related businesses exist along Rt 27 between Costco and Highland Park, but itâs not as concentrated as Oak Tree Rd Little India
BaBaBroke t1_jcl4ras wrote
There are some bad actors on those apps so be careful. Screenshot their info from the app you find them on, photo copy their driver license and get their license plate number. Hide grannies valuables or put them in a safe that is bolted down. That is just for the property.
You might consider a nanny cam to make sure there is no elder abuse.
Stop in unannounced.
